#b1a72c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1a72c is composed of 69.4% red, 65.5%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.6% magenta, 75.1%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 55.5 degrees, a saturation of 60.2% and a lightness of 43.3%. #b1a72c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ff58 with #634f00.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

Shades and Tints of #b1a72c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040401 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b1a72c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767468 is the less saturated color, while #dccb01 is the most saturated one.
